With Kyle's permission, I am going to launch an activity of my own, especially created for those of you who just never seem to have enough options to stretch your authoring skills to the limits and beyond.

At its heart, this is a new marathon quiz authoring race requiring a combination of speed, persistence, quality and variance. While you could win up to six badges(*) for finishing, those are standard awards you'll just happen to pick up on the way (unless you already have them). Essentially, you are thus competing for the love of authoring and for the bragging rights to have completed one of the most demanding authoring quests that will ever hit the site.

The race is open to every FT author and will run for as long as people wish to continue working on it. You can start the race at any time by signing up. Then, your goal is to write one sunglassed quiz per category, begun after the signup date (those you wrote before don't count). Each of these must be for an author challenge or for an author lounge activity (lounge challenge, commission). Report your finished works here once they have received their Sunnies to be added to the leaderboard. Finishers will be sorted by the time needed from signup to their 20th set of shades (so late starters will never be penalized). If anyone does this under a year, they're a master author, but anyone seeing this to the end will be a champion in their own right.

Oh yes, should you finish this and want to try again to improve your time, feel free to reenter. We'll keep your best time and your number of completions!

A few answers before you ask the corresponding questions:

  • In order not to penalize those who have taken an early jump at "Stepping Up XII", you *may* count a quiz you've done for that challenge even if you have already begun it. If you wish to do so, just notify me with your signup that you wish to retroactively sign up as of yesterday (March 1).
  • Quizzes written for The Amazing Trivia Race by those not yet arrived do count only if they are also author challenges and have been begun on March 1 or later.
  • If you still have to create a work in any other challenge or commission you entered before your signup date which you have never yet submitted to an editor, you CAN finish, submit and count it. This would be a good time to catch up on your commissions!
  • If you get an Editor's Choice on a quiz, it will qualify even if does not get actual Sunnies. This is also a great way to avoid the wait for ratings and shave several weeks off your score!
  • Once a quiz has been crosschecked and marked off on your grid, it does not matter whether it does retain its Sunny status later on. Once qualified, it remains qualified.
  • You are responsible for reporting your quizzes yourself in this thread once they do qualify (please provide a link for quick checking). It's best to check on Monday afternoon or Tuesday, that way you will always catch those newly awarded Sunnies early.
  • If you have added no new quizzes to your score for three months, your name will be dropped from the public listing of racers. However, you will remain in the internal database and once you do submit another qualifying quiz, you will be back in the list. This is just to weed out those who abandoned the game.
  • I will provide regular updates to the standings once the first quizzes start rolling in (which will obviously take 3-4 weeks). Kyle will be using his magical mod powers to add them to this post.
  • To make things easy for me, please do not link to your quizzes in this thread until they qualify.

    If you have any further questions, just ask away. Good luck!
